The Opportunity

Eve is growing fast, and we’re building the financial infrastructure to match. We’re hiring a Strategic Finance Manager to work on some of Eve’s most pressing business problems. You’ll serve as the connective tissue between Finance and the rest of the company — owning core financial infrastructure, driving planning and analysis, and partnering directly with leaders across every function. No two weeks will look the same.You’ll get substantial visibility, work on the highest-priority issues in the business, and be plugged into every facet of how Eve operates and grows. This is a generalist, operator-first role for someone who thrives on ownership. This role reports to the Director of Strategic Finance.

Key Responsibilities
  • Own and continuously improve the company-wide financial model — maintaining accuracy, incorporating actuals, and evolving the forecast as the business scales
  • Drive alignment on KPIs and key metrics to monitor business performance, support growth initiatives, and provide visibility into operating performance
  • Become a trusted thought partner to functional leaders and the executive team
    • Example: Collaborate with Marketing leadership to build spend visibility, measure channel ROI, and connect demand generation investment to pipeline outcomes
  • Experiment with AI-driven approaches to automate workflows, improve accuracy, and increase the speed and impact of the finance function
  • Take on high-impact ad hoc projects that don’t fit neatly into a job description but provide outsized leverage to the business
What You'll Bring (Required Qualifications)
  • 3–5 years of experience in strategic finance, FP&A, investment banking, management consulting, or private equity; high-growth SaaS experience strongly preferred
  • Strong understanding of SaaS business models and the ability to connect metrics to the operating decisions that drive them — not just report the numbers
  • Excellent financial modeling skills; able to build models from scratch, maintain rigor under pressure, and clearly explain logic to any audience
  • Experience building relationships and communicating effectively with stakeholders across all levels and functions
  • Naturally curious mindset — you ask why the number moved, not just what it is
Educational Background
  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Mathematics, Engineering, or another STEM field
Preferred Qualifications
  • Prior marketing finance experience, including familiarity with demand generation economics, channel ROI, and spend efficiency analysis
  • Experience using modern FP&A software (e.g., Pigment, Aleph) and/or modern data and BI tools (e.g., Hex, Omni)

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
